Cloudland offers a range of exquisitely designed private wedding rooms, catering to both grand opulence and intimate celebrations. Our experienced Wedding Executive will work closely with you to bring your vision to life.
The idyllic location for Whitsundays destination weddings, InterContinental Hayman Great Barrier Reef, offers a luxury wedding experience with 15 indoor and outdoor spaces, exceptional service and accommodation.
Waters Edge Weddings & Events is Brisbane’s most spectacular new waterfront wedding destination. Suited to both intimate and grand scale weddings and events, this beautiful venue combines style and sophistication with a laidback Brisbane feel.
Bring the rustic charm of the Herveys Range Heritage Tea Rooms to your wedding celebration. Set amongst 25 acres of bush land, the heritage listed Tea Rooms is the perfect setting for an intimate gathering of family and friends.

Celebrate your Port Douglas wedding at the most magnificent, magical, rainforest ballroom in Australia – the award-winning Flames of the Forest.
Fleay’s newly renovated ceremony and reception spaces provide a gorgeous, serene sanctuary. Our Grove is perfect for small elopements and our Lakeview ampitheatre can cater even enormous gala weddings.
Be part of the whole story and dine in the Rainforest Restaurant with its seasonal flavours or the Terrace Café for a quick bite. As a top conference and wedding destination, it has earned national, state and local accolades for excellence.
Mackay Northern Beaches Bowls Club is a unique community-owned and operated wedding venue on the Coral Sea coast. The Club has several beautiful event spaces and provides exceptional service and delicious food, with an authentic tropical vibe.
Award-Winning Queensland Wedding Venue Estate, located in the beautiful Sunshine Coast Hinterland Flaxton Gardens is an iconic wedding venue with some of the best views across the coastline from Moreton Island to Noosa.
A premier wedding venue, unlike any other, Villa Botanica, overlooks the stunning Whitsunday Islands and Airlie Beach. We specialise in creating the most perfect and private dream wedding for all of our couples.

How can couples incorporate local culture into their wedding at Queensland venues?
Queensland offers a wealth of cultural experiences that couples can weave into their wedding celebrations. Many romantic venues, such as the picturesque Spicers Tamarind Retreat, can incorporate local cuisine, featuring dishes made from regional ingredients and inspired by Queensland’s culinary heritage. Couples might also consider including local entertainment, such as musicians or performers, showcasing traditional Australian music or dance. Personalising décor with locally sourced materials or indigenous art can further enrich the cultural experience. Discussing these options with the venue’s coordinator will help couples create a unique, culturally infused wedding day.

How do Queensland venues handle wedding planning and coordination?
Many romantic wedding venues in Queensland, like the Gold Coast's Palazzo Versace, provide dedicated wedding coordinators to assist couples throughout the planning process. These coordinators help manage details such as catering, décor, and logistics, ensuring a seamless experience. Couples can benefit from the venue's expertise in local vendors, facilitating connections for flowers, photography, and entertainment. Some venues also offer comprehensive wedding packages, simplifying the planning process. Open communication with the coordinator helps ensure that all aspects align with the couple's vision, reducing stress and enhancing the overall experience.
